Damages

If a collision with a tennessee semi truck accident lawsuit truck occurs, victims typically incur significant medical bills and may are unable to earn income. The damage is typically more extensive than in the crash of a car due to the fact that semi trucks are heavier and larger. Additionally, the loss of life or serious injuries are more common in this type of accident. The average semi-truck accident settlement is dependent on the particular case as there are numerous factors that influence the settlement of the lawsuit and compensation awarded to the victim.

One of the most important factors in determining a settlement is the extent of the injuries sustained. This is based on the type and severity of emotional, psychological and physical injuries. Long-term injuries may affect the amount of compensation awarded.

A seasoned attorney will estimate the total losses suffered by a victim of an accident with semi-truck. This can include present and future medical expenses and income loss and enjoyment of life, and other costs that can have a permanent impact on the quality of life of the person. A lawyer will collaborate with doctors and expert witnesses to assess the full impact of the injury.

A successful claim could help the injured person to be compensated for their loss of capacity to live a normal lifestyle. In certain situations there are punitive damages that can be added to compensatory damages. This is typically the case when a company has clearly ignored safety rules or routine maintenance procedures.

In general the more serious and extensive the injury, then the more money will be awarded. There are also many other factors that determine how much the victim will get. This includes state liability laws, contributory negligence, value of assets that are lost or destroyed and insurance policy limits.

Medical bills

Anyone who has been in a collision with a semi-truck understands how devastating the collision can be. These massive trucks, often called tractor-trailers, or commercial trucks, weigh several times more than a typical passenger car, which makes them more likely to cause serious damage in a crash. These accidents can also cause serious injuries that can have a life-changing impact. As a result, victims of truck accidents tend to rack up huge medical bills which can quickly add up.

Medical bills are only one type of damages that a victim may seek in a suit filed against the trucking company, or the driver that was involved in an accident. Victims may also be able to claim compensation for their loss of wages, hospitalization costs rehabilitation expenses, past and future suffering and loss of consortium, permanent injuries, and other damages. In the case of wrongful death families can seek compensation for funeral expenses, future loss of income, and other damages.

Semi truck settlements are typically much higher than the average settlement for a car accident. This is due to the sheer size of these vehicles and the severity of crash. This is why it's important not to sign anything from an insurance company including settlement offers, or medical release forms. Doing so could hurt your case because it allows the insurance company access to your medical history, which they can use against you later on in the case to decrease or deny your claim.

In the aftermath of a semi truck crash, it is critical to seek immediate medical attention for any injuries. Keep track of all appointments, and ensure that you record each treatment. This will help ensure that your injuries are properly treated and can also provide valuable evidence in your case.

In addition, you should take pictures of the scene of the accident, as well as the vehicle that was damaged. This will assist you and your lawyer create a compelling argument for the reason you should receive an equitable settlement. If you can you should record the plate number from the truck and any witnesses that may have seen the accident.

Lost wages

A successful insurance claim could aid in the payment of the many expenses that arise from the event of a semi-truck accident. These costs include the loss of wages, medical expenses as well as property damage and emotional stress. In addition, compensation may be awarded for pain and suffering as well as loss of consortium. People who are involved in a collision with a commercial vehicle may also claim damages in the event of the death of loved ones.

Accidents involving semi trucks are more severe than car crashes due to the weight and size of the vehicles. Therefore, the law requires truck drivers to follow an extra high standard of care when driving. The law also provides rules that govern maintenance of trucks as well as the eligibility of drivers and capacity of cargo. Failure to follow these laws can lead to disastrous injuries if you collide with a semi.

You may be required to be off work while recovering from an accident involving a semi, depending on the severity of your injuries. You could also have missed work due to the time you were off following the accident to deal with it and make your insurance claim. In some cases the injuries you suffer could make you permanently disabled and not able to earn a living.

In these scenarios it is important to document all financial losses and loss of income. Your lawyer will be able to assess the value of your case, and if you're successful with an insurance claim, it will be used to pay these expenses. They will take into consideration a range of factors, including economic damages which can be established through paytubs and receipts as well as non-economic losses such as a loss in enjoyment of living or pain and discomfort.
